Abstract:
A fabrication method for fabricating a metal oxide film introduces H2 gas and O2 gas or, H2O2 gas, into a catalytic reactor to make contact with a catalyst to generate H2O gas. The H2O gas that is generated is jetted from the catalytic reactor to react with a metal compound gas, to thereby deposit the metal oxide thin film on a substrate and fabricate the metal oxide thin film.
Abstract:
A smoking article includes a carbon monoxide reducing agent including particles including a calcium aluminate represented by the formula (CaO)m(Al2O3)n, where 1/6≦m/n≦4/1, wherein the particles have a BET specific surface area of 2 m2/g or more and less than 20 m2/g.

Abstract:
A carbon monoxide reduction catalyst for smoking articles includes particles, 90% by volume or more of which have a particle diameter within a range of 1 to 100 μm. Each particle includes a transition metal oxide generated by heating a transition metal salt of an organic acid.
Abstract:
In a solid electrolyte fuel cell which includes a solid electrolyte device having electrodes formed on both surfaces of an oxygen ion-conductive solid electrolyte substrate and wherein oxygen is supplied to the electrode on the cathode side and methane gas, as fuel, is supplied to the electrode on the anode side of the solid electrolyte device, metal oxide particles consisting of CoNiO2 are blended, as an oxidation catalyst for the methane gas, with a porous platinum layer forming substantially the electrode on the anode side of the solid electrolyte device.

Abstract:
A disclosed substrate processing apparatus comprises a reaction chamber; a substrate supporting portion that is provided in the reaction chamber and configured to support a substrate; and plural catalyst reaction portions that are arranged in the reaction chamber in order to oppose the substrate supporting portion, and configured to produce a reaction gas by allowing a source gas introduced from a gas introduction portion to contact a catalyst and to eject the reaction gas to an inner space of the reaction chamber, thereby processing the substrate supported by the substrate supporting portion with the ejected reaction gas.

Abstract:
A solid electrolyte fuel cell having an anode including an oxidation catalyst of a gaseous compound fine in size and superior in oxidation action able to eliminate pulverization work is provided. The oxidation catalyst is of a gaseous compound comprising a catalyst for promoting an oxidation reaction of a gaseous compound by oxygen ions supplied through a solid electrolyte under an environment where no oxygen molecules are present, comprising metal oxide particles produced by firing a precipitate comprised of a mixture of two types of metal hydrates obtained by coprecipitation from a mixed solution of two types of metal salts of different metal positive ions dissolved together, the composition of said metal oxide particles being expressed by the formula ABO2 (where, A is one element selected from the group consisting of Pd, Pt, Cu, and Ag, B is one element selected from the group consisting of Co, Cr, Rh, Al, Ga, Fe, In, Sc, and Tl).
